











During the 20 years that I was an actor, I also did a lot of illustration work, both for my own pleasure and as a way of earning a living in the lean times. It was quite a useful 'second string' to have as well as enabling me to make a small but welcome income from what was essentially a hobby.
I worked almost exclusively in the science-fiction and fantasy genre, producing work for publishers, magazines and games manufacturers. Most of my commercial work was done in pencil or pen & ink, but I did do a few larger, colour paintings in oils or acrylics. More recently, I've been moving into the digital realm and producing work directly in the computer.
